1 Narrow Down Your Potential News Headlines
You need to make a list of news that sounds interesting to you and can help your viewers find out about the industry in which you are dealing. You can take a recap and find out what the people are searching for in your blog month after month.
To get your topics, you can use tools like Google Trends to know more about the relative popularity of any search queries that you enter. The only issue with Google Trends is that it doesn’t show you the search volume of the queries.

3 Keep Your Facts Handy
In online article writing, you need to provide facts and sources. According to Copyblogger, when you are writing a news article in your blog, you need to add some points that make the upcoming statements trustworthy and give your headline the support it needs.
A crisp summary of the whole news in less than 50 words can help you engage better with your readers who are in a hurry to know the facts. Others who want to go deep in the story can always go through the entire article.
Once you have provided the facts and data, you can build your post around it and discuss it further in your blogpost. You can share your opinion on how these pieces will impact your readers.

5 Keep It Simple
That means don’t try to show your vocabulary by adding jargon in the text. When writing news about your niche, it’s a good idea to keep jargons off the shore. This will make your post easier to read and help your readers grasp the context in a better way. Moreover, when using an acronym, always write it out for the first time.
6 Go through Intense Research
When you are writing an article for blogs, you must take your time with the research. You need to cite the facts that you are putting in your story. Also, don’t trust the one website. Always look for another website for a fact check. Thus, it will help you know everything about the topic which the internet has to offer. In addition to this, the research and the fact-checking will make you aware of your mistakes which you can then rectify before posting the article.

8 Proofread For The Win
Once you are done writing your news, let it rest awhile, just like the chef who rests food to enhance its flavors. Take a break, do something else, and after some time re-read it .This way you can find where the narration is getting convoluted. You can discover all those pesky mistakes which you missed earlier, now when you proofread your content after some time.
